Thumbs up Futureshop rocks!

On the 15th of September (just before my birthday on the 18th) my wife bought me an 80GB PS3 for $660 (Canadian), plus some other stuff (Blu-ray remote, Ridge Racer 7, etc.).

This past Thursday (the 18th), I noticed that Futureshop had dropped their proce for the 80GB bundle to $499 and threw in an extra game. I know that they have a 30 day price match guarantee, so even though I was just over that limit, I went to my local Futureshop to see if they'd refund me the difference and give me a copy of the extra game. I was pleasently surprised when they said yes! :-)
